मुझे कैसे पता चलेगा कि मेरा Android अग्रभूमि या पृष्ठभूमि है?
मुझे कैसे पता चलेगा कि कोई ऐप बैकग्राउंड में है या फ़ोरग्राउंड Android?
निम्नलिखित कोड का उपयोग करके आप पता लगा सकते हैं कि ऐप अग्रभूमि में आता है या नहीं। यह पता लगाने का तरीका है कि ऐप पृष्ठभूमि में है या नहीं।
…
कॉलबैक अनुक्रम होगा,
- रोकने पर ()
- onStop() (-activityReferences ==0) (ऐप पृष्ठभूमि में प्रवेश करता है ??)
- नष्ट करने पर ()
- ऑनक्रिएट ()
- ऑनस्टार्ट() (++गतिविधि संदर्भ ==1) (ऐप अग्रभूमि में प्रवेश करता है ??)
- ऑन रिज्यूमे ()
अग्रभूमि और पृष्ठभूमि android क्या है?
अग्रभूमि उन सक्रिय ऐप्स को संदर्भित करता है जो डेटा की खपत करते हैं और वर्तमान में मोबाइल पर चल रहे हैं . बैकग्राउंड उस डेटा को संदर्भित करता है जिसका उपयोग तब किया जाता है जब ऐप पृष्ठभूमि में कुछ गतिविधि कर रहा होता है, जो अभी सक्रिय नहीं है।
आपको कैसे पता चलेगा कि गतिविधि अग्रभूमि में है या दृश्यमान पृष्ठभूमि में है?
अपनी फिनिश () विधि में, आप isActivityVisible() . का उपयोग करना चाहते हैं यह जांचने के लिए कि गतिविधि दिखाई दे रही है या नहीं। वहां आप यह भी जांच सकते हैं कि उपयोगकर्ता ने कोई विकल्प चुना है या नहीं। दोनों शर्तें पूरी होने पर जारी रखें।
कौन सा API सूचित करता है कि ऐप अग्रभूमि है या पृष्ठभूमि?
ऐपस्टेट आपको बता सकता है कि ऐप अग्रभूमि या पृष्ठभूमि में है, और राज्य बदलने पर आपको सूचित कर सकता है। ऐपस्टेट का उपयोग अक्सर पुश नोटिफिकेशन को हैंडल करते समय इरादे और उचित व्यवहार को निर्धारित करने के लिए किया जाता है।
मुझे कैसे पता चलेगा कि कौन से ऐप्स बैकग्राउंड में चल रहे हैं?
पृष्ठभूमि में वर्तमान में कौन से Android ऐप्स चल रहे हैं, यह देखने की प्रक्रिया में निम्नलिखित चरण शामिल हैं-
- अपने Android की "सेटिंग" पर जाएं
- नीचे स्क्रॉल करें। ...
- नीचे "बिल्ड नंबर" शीर्षक तक स्क्रॉल करें।
- “बिल्ड नंबर” शीर्षक पर सात बार टैप करें - सामग्री लिखें।
- “वापस जाएं” बटन पर टैप करें।
- “डेवलपर विकल्प” पर टैप करें
- “चल रही सेवाएं” पर टैप करें
क्या Android ऐप बैकग्राउंड में है?
सुपर के बाद आप जांच सकते हैं कि आपका ऐप आपकी गतिविधि की ऑनपॉज़ () विधि में अग्रभूमि में है या नहीं। ऑन पॉज़ ()। बस उस अजीब लिम्बो स्टेट को याद रखें जिसके बारे में मैंने अभी बात की है। आप सुपर के बाद अपनी गतिविधि की ऑनस्टॉप() विधि में देख सकते हैं कि आपका ऐप दिखाई दे रहा है (यानी अगर यह पृष्ठभूमि में नहीं है)।
अग्रभूमि और पृष्ठभूमि में क्या अंतर है?
अग्रभूमि में वे एप्लिकेशन शामिल हैं जिन पर उपयोगकर्ता काम कर रहा है , और पृष्ठभूमि में ऐसे अनुप्रयोग होते हैं जो परदे के पीछे होते हैं, जैसे कुछ ऑपरेटिंग सिस्टम फ़ंक्शन, दस्तावेज़ प्रिंट करना या नेटवर्क तक पहुंच बनाना।
अग्रभूमि और पृष्ठभूमि डेटा में क्या अंतर है?
"अग्रभूमि" उस डेटा को संदर्भित करता है जिसका उपयोग तब किया जाता है जब आपसक्रिय रूप से ऐप का उपयोग करते हुए, जबकि "बैकग्राउंड" ऐप के बैकग्राउंड में चलने पर उपयोग किए गए डेटा को दर्शाता है।
अग्रभूमि और पृष्ठभूमि सेवा में क्या अंतर है?
अग्रभूमि सेवाएं भी चलती रहती हैं जब उपयोगकर्ता ऐप के साथ इंटरैक्ट नहीं कर रहा हो। जब आप अग्रभूमि सेवा का उपयोग करते हैं, तो आपको एक सूचना प्रदर्शित करनी चाहिए ताकि उपयोगकर्ता सक्रिय रूप से जान सकें कि सेवा चल रही है। ... एक पृष्ठभूमि सेवा एक ऐसा ऑपरेशन करती है जिस पर उपयोगकर्ता सीधे ध्यान नहीं देता है।
क्या गतिविधि अग्रभूमि Android में है?
Android 10 या उसके बाद वाले वर्शन पर चलने वाले ऐप्स केवल तभी गतिविधियां शुरू कर सकते हैं जब निम्न में से एक या अधिक शर्तें पूरी हों:ऐप में एक दृश्यमान विंडो है , जैसे अग्रभूमि में कोई गतिविधि। ऐप में अग्रभूमि कार्य के बैक स्टैक में एक गतिविधि है। ... ऐप में एक सेवा है जो सिस्टम द्वारा बाध्य है।
आप Android ऐप्स को बैकग्राउंड में चलने से कैसे रोकते हैं?
एंड्रॉइड पर बैकग्राउंड में ऐप्स को चलने से कैसे रोकें
- सेटिंग> ऐप्स पर जाएं।
- एक ऐप चुनें जिसे आप रोकना चाहते हैं, फिर फोर्स स्टॉप पर टैप करें। यदि आप ऐप को फोर्स स्टॉप चुनते हैं, तो यह आपके वर्तमान एंड्रॉइड सत्र के दौरान बंद हो जाता है। ...
- ऐप केवल तब तक बैटरी या मेमोरी संबंधी समस्याओं को दूर करता है जब तक आप अपना फ़ोन पुनः प्रारंभ नहीं करते।
अनुमति अग्रभूमि गतिविधि क्या है?
IMHO हाँ, मूल रूप से अग्रभूमि एक ऐसी स्थिति है जिसमें उपयोगकर्ता बातचीत . कर सकता है गतिविधि या सेवा जैसे एंड्रॉइड घटक के माध्यम से आवेदन के साथ। अग्रभूमि सेवा में संगीत बजाने वाले संगीत का उदाहरण लें। इसके अलावा अगर आपको एक्टिविटी के माध्यम से एप्लिकेशन के साथ इंटरैक्ट करना है, तो गतिविधि को अग्रभूमि में होना चाहिए।